React router pass params. Child routes inherit all params from their parent routes


  • A Night of Discovery


    push(url) doesn't seem to register query params, and it doesn't seem like you can pass … How to Use Query Parameters With React. This … The type for the loaderData prop is automatically generated. But can't find any examples of it const AdminRoutes: FunctionComponent = () =&gt; { const … In this guide, we will explore the seamless integration of query parameters within React Router. URL parameters help in identifying specific … I am using react with react-router. x I recently published an article on how to set up a basic navigator using the react-navigation 5 You can remove the id from route params if you don't need it this way. carList thanks Storing Data in React Router: A lot of data that developers might be tempted to store in React state has a more natural home in React Router, such as: URL Search Params: Parameters within the URL that … Learn once, Route Anywhere Handle loading states - While fetching param-based data Update params carefully - Preserve other params when updating Document param formats - Especially for complex patterns Route parameters … URL Values Framework Data Declarative Route Params Route params are the parsed values from a dynamic segment. When working with React, do you pass parameters when routing by chaining them to the URL or as state? Is there even a best practice to … Params is an important feature of React Router, which helps to retrieve data from URLs through Dynamic Router. Let’s take a look at how we can pass objects! Passing props through Link’s state This is what props passing through <Link> looks like in the docs: Passing props through the <Link> … Is it possible to pass an object via Link component in react-router? Something like: &lt;Link to='home' params={{myObj: obj}}&gt; Click &lt;/Link&gt; In the same way as I would pass props from the How to Get URL Params in ReactJS with or without router ( With Code Examples ) In ReactJS, accessing URL parameters is common when building dynamic pages. push('/page') in React Router v4? Pass params to a route by putting them in an object as a second parameter to the navigation. React Router v5 has a built in method to take in your url pattern and an object that maps to the params of the url called generatePath https://v5. Navigate : history. push and history. Optional Segments … Have router export const router = createBrowserRouter([ { path: '/todos/:todoId', element: &lt;Todo /&gt;, loader: todoLoader, } ]); Have loader export const loader In my App. I'm new in react router v6 so i need to add custom params in route object. In order for that to work you need to use the route name in the to property of Link component, otherwise router can't know which route definition you mean and therefore what to do … Warning: You should not use <Route render> and <Route children> in the same route; <Route render> will be ignored So based on that warning you can see that your Redirect is being … React Router provides several ways to pass data between pages, depending on your specific use case. Child routes inherit all params from their parent routes. So, when you call … Without React Router, the browser would have made a Request to your server, but React Router prevented it! Instead of the browser sending the request to your server, React Router sends the … In this up-to-date post, you'll learn how to pass data through React Router's Link component to a new route. This is essential for building applications with dynamic content like user profiles, product pages, or … Learn how to utilize route parameters in React Router effectively. Expo Router provides hooks for accessing and modifying these parameters. So that’s what I wanted to share today: How to add, and … Learn how to utilize route parameters in React Router effectively. Example: I want to pass the id parameter to the … Overview of React Router 6 and its importance in building dynamic web applications. JS + React Router What is a Query Parameter? Query parameters are a defined set of parameters attached to the end of a url. navigate('RouteName', { /* params go here */ }) Read the params in … Routing Framework Data Declarative Configuring Routes Routes are configured as the first argument to createBrowserRouter. I know that we could set query param in the URL to somehow pass parameters to the loader function. Note: When you want to get the queries from the URL, you can use the useSearchParams, But when you want to get the params you defined in your Route component and path prop, you can use the useParams Passing parameters to routes Use useRouter hook To pass parameters to a route, we can use navigate, push or replace methods from the useRouter hook. Path params in TanStack Router help match URL segments and retrieve their values as named variables, enhancing routing capabilities in React applications. Learn how to efficiently pass and retrieve query parameters in both React Router v5 and the latest version, React Router v6.

    yia8uoqsi
    9zy9hazxkl
    2lrxvqg6
    xbc1bmvb
    1s7zwrzz
    cuccgxcpz
    dncsqe
    h5q5uahu
    hsscaf6
    5xju7v